Tell me more
Leading Me is a twice-annual cohort, in the fall and in the spring, in which women will be paired with a mentor with the goal of showing up fully in their workplaces and in their lives.
- The six-month program starts with a full-day retreat, and then participants meet monthly, in addition to regular meetings with their mentor.
- The program maxes out at 25 participants, but Hiatt said even if you're not accepted into the cohort you apply to, you'll be able to join the next time around.
"If it's something you want to do, you're in," she said. "Iβm hearing from too many women who are shying away from applying because they didnβt think they would get in. If youβre interested in growing as a person and building a career you enjoy, these programs are for you. You just need to apply."
Leading With is also a twice-annual cohort, in the fall and spring, designed for women who are 10 to 15 years into their leadership journey. It's a smaller group and structured more as business coaching.
- This program is designed to help women understand their impact on others, and it involves some introspection in looking at their family of origin and how learned patterns might be impacting their work and leadership.
Leading Wise is, in some ways, still forming, Hiatt said, but the goal is to create a clearinghouse for women in the community to share their expertise with others.
- The goal is to meet community needs as they arise and give women with expertise a way to share their offering with more people.
- One aspect of Leading Wise is The Bold Table, a partnership with Bold Identity Studio to create a space for women to share a table and glean wisdom from one another.
